A recent survey found that 65% of high school students were currently enrolled in a math class,43% were currently enrolled in a science class,and 13% were enrolled in both a math and a science class. Suppose a high school student who is enrolled in a math class is selected at random. What is the probability that the student is also enrolled in a science class?

Answers

Answer: 0.20

Step-by-step explanation:

As per given :

P(student enrolled in a math class ) = 65% = 0.65

P( student enrolled in a science class) = 43%= 0.43

P( student enrolled in both ) = 13% = 0.13

Formula of conditional probability :

[tex]P(A|B)=\dfrac{P(A\text{ and }B)}{P(B)}[/tex]

Using the above formula,

The probability that the student is enrolled in a science class given that he is enrolled in maths class :

[tex]P(\text{science}|\text{math})=\dfrac{P(\text{science and maths})}{P(\text{math})}\\\\=\dfrac{0.13}{0.65}\\\\=\dfrac{13}{65}\\\\=\dfrac{1}{5}=0.20[/tex]

Hence, the probability that the student is also enrolled in a science class =  0.20 .

During the recent recession, Bob's home value dropped to only $175,000. Since then the economy has turned around and the market is improving at a rate of 4.5% annually. At this rate, how much will Bob's home be worth 12 years after the market started improving? And what equation did you use?

Answers

Answer:

Bob's home will worth $296,779.25 after 12 years.

Equation used is [tex]FV = $175,000( 1 + 4.5/100)^(12)\\[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Current value of Bob's house =[tex]FV = $175,000( 1 + 4.5/100)^12\\FV = $175,000( (100+ 4.5)/100)^12\\FV = $175,000( (104.5)/100)^12\\FV = $296,779.25[/tex]

market is improving at 4.5% annually.

This, means that the value of house gets appreciated by 4.5% each year from its previous year value.

This is a problem of compound interest formula

[tex]FV = PV(1+r/100)^n[/tex]

where PV is the present value of any thing

FV is the future value

r is the annual rate of interest

t is the time in number of year for which rate is applicable.

_____________________________________

Given

PV = $175,000.

r = 4.5%

t = 12 years

Value after 12 year will be given by

[tex]FV = $175,000( 1 + 4.5/100)^(12)\\FV = $175,000( (100+ 4.5)/100)^(12)\\FV = $175,000( (104.5)/100)^(12)\\FV = $296,779.25[/tex]

Thus, Bob's home will worth $296,779.25 after 12 years.

Equation used is [tex]FV = $175,000( 1 + 4.5/100)^(12)\\[/tex]

Angelo cuts a piece of wood for a project. The first cut is shown and can be represented by the equation y - 5x-1. The second cut needs to be parallel to the first. It will pass through the point (0,6). Identify the equation that
represents Angelo's second cut.

Answers

Answer:

The correct option is A

A) y = (1/5)x + 6

Step-by-step explanation:

The equation of the first cut shown in the graph is:

y = (1/5)x - 1

We know that a general form of linear equation is given as:

y = mx + c

Comparing both equations, we get that the slope m = 1/5

As the second cut is parallel to the first cut, it will have the same slope, that is m = 1/5

Substitute it in the general linear equation

y = mx + c

y = (1/5)x + c

We know that this equation passes through the point (0,6), substitute it in  the above equation>

6 = (1/5)(0) + c

c = 6

The equation for second cut be found by using m = 1/5 and c = 6

y = mx + c

y = (1/5)x + 6
